What is the criteria for spontaneity in terms of free energy change?

Criteria for spontaneity in terms of free energy change: (i) If ∆G is negative, the process is spontaneous. (ii) If ∆G is positive, the direct process is non-spontaneous. (iii) If ∆G is zero, the process is in equilibrium.

What are the basic steps in planning process?

The steps in the planning process are:

  • Develop objectives.
  • Develop tasks to meet those objectives.
  • Determine resources needed to implement tasks.
  • Create a timeline.
  • Determine tracking and assessment method.
  • Finalize plan.
  • Distribute to all involved in the process.
